Output e61b3dec3546edb2c01e7632da0d8137ad7b7cc56c9d52493b41fef44fb8bf97:6

value
33180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ad02e655037e4cefe65d40a82e65f72a79b6391 OP_EQUAL
address
3HGCBqi3zRnGqg7GfiUipr6vhtpnMDP2pt
transaction
e61b3dec3546edb2c01e7632da0d8137ad7b7cc56c9d52493b41fef44fb8bf97
confirmations
475549
spent
true